本站资源收集于互联网,不提供软件存储服务,每天免费更新优质的软件以及学习资源!

typescript怎么设置接口

电脑教程 app 1℃

typescript怎么设置接口
typescript 通过使用接口来定义对象的形状,包括属性和方法,以增强类型安全性、可读性、可维护性和可重用性。设置接口时使用 interface 关键字,并在接口名称后使用大括号指定属性和方法。通过类型化变量、函数和对象,接口可以强制执行对象的特定形状,从而在编译时捕捉类型错误。

如何使用 TypeScript 设置接口

TypeScript 是一种强大的 JavaScript 超集,允许开发者使用类型系统来定义变量、函数和对象。接口是 TypeScript 中的一种关键概念,它允许开发者指定对象的形状,包括它可以拥有的属性和方法。

设置接口

要设置一个接口,可以使用 interface 关键字,后面跟接口名称和大括号:

interface Person { name: string; age: number; greet(): string;}

这个接口定义了一个 Person 对象,它有 name(字符串)和 age(数字)两个属性,以及一个 greet() 方法(返回字符串)。

使用接口

一旦接口被定义,就可以使用它来类型化变量、函数和对象:

类型化变量:

let person: Person;

类型化函数:

function createPerson(name: string, age: number): Person {return { name, age, greet() { return `Hello, my name is ${this.name}!`; },};}

类型化对象:

const john: Person = {name: "John Doe",age: 42,greet() { return `Hello, my name is ${this.name}!`;},};

接口的好处

使用接口有以下好处:

增强类型安全性:接口强制执行对象遵守特定的形状,有助于在编译时捕捉类型错误。提高代码可读性和可维护性:接口清楚地说明了对象的预期结构,使其对其他开发者更容易理解和维护。代码重用:接口可以被多个类和函数重用,从而提高代码的可重用性。支持泛型:接口可以与泛型一起使用,为广泛的对象类型创建可重用的代码。

以上就是typescript怎么设置接口的详细内容,更多请关注范的资源库其它相关文章!

引用来源:https://app.fanyaozu.com/382460.html

转载请注明:范的资源库 » typescript怎么设置接口

喜欢 (0)